Send us a message to get in touch with one of our experienced technicians!

The information you entered has been submitted.

Thanks for your feedback!

Need more immediate help?

Northeast US Region

36 Exchange Terrace

Suite 200

Providence, RI 02904

(401) 490-4444


Southeast US Region

1900 Glades Rd

Suite 450

Boca Raton, FL 33431

(561) 232-2060